Benefits of an Ensuite Bedroom with Walk-In Closet
One of the most significant benefits of having an ensuite bedroom with a walk-in closet is the privacy it provides. You can have your own personal space where you can relax and unwind without any interruptions. Additionally, having a walk-in closet means you have ample storage space, which helps keep your bedroom tidy and clutter-free.
Another benefit of having an ensuite bedroom with a walk-in closet is the convenience it provides. You don’t have to walk to a separate bathroom, which saves you time and energy. Moreover, having a walk-in closet means that you can easily find your clothes and accessories without rummaging through piles of clothes, which can be stressful and time-consuming.
Designing Your Ensuite Bedroom with Walk-In Closet
Layout
The first step in designing your ensuite bedroom with a walk-in closet is to consider the layout. You want to ensure that the space is functional and meets your needs. An ideal layout would be to have the bathroom directly connected to the bedroom, with the walk-in closet adjacent to it.
Lighting
The lighting in your ensuite bedroom with a walk-in closet is crucial to creating a relaxing and comfortable space. You want to ensure that there is plenty of natural light and that the artificial lighting is soft and warm. Consider installing dimmer switches to control the lighting and create a cozy ambiance.
Storage
Storage is key when it comes to designing your walk-in closet. You want to ensure that you have ample space for your clothes, shoes, and accessories. Consider installing customized shelves, drawers, and hanging rods to maximize the space and keep everything organized.
Color Scheme
The color scheme of your ensuite bedroom with a walk-in closet should be soothing and relaxing. Consider using neutral tones such as beige, cream, or gray, which create a calming atmosphere. You can add pops of color with accessories such as pillows, rugs, and artwork.
